Output 32b8b832ef2f544b9cb1005ce65b78fa6147a7940cb244d7cb43bf2ac699bfa5:0

value
34000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420e302d50d827ece0bc5c56e8bef66398500780 OP_EQUAL
address
37iHX1xk3ribvcYfokR6B5n8scZJAFWLcW
transaction
32b8b832ef2f544b9cb1005ce65b78fa6147a7940cb244d7cb43bf2ac699bfa5